Adjunct Professor Bhekinkosi Moyo

African Philanthropy

Job Title
Adjunct Professor and Director: Centre on African Philanthropy and Social Investment
Qualifications PhD (Politics), Wits.
Organisational Unit Wits Business School
Biography

Courses and Disciplines taught at WBS:
Social Entrepreneurship Initiatives; Principles and Fundamentals on Fundraising; Introduction to African Philanthropy and Gifting; Landscaping African Philanthropy; Finance for Social Enterprises; Liquid Leadership.

Other Teaching Experience:
Guest lecturing at other universities including Cambridge University’s Centre for Strategic Philanthropy; University of Geneva’s Centre for Philanthropy, and University of Pretoria’s Centre for Human Rights.

Research Interests:
African politics; global governance; development; civil society; philanthropy; social investment; political economy; International Political Economy (IPE); South-South relations; democracy; pan-Africanism, African regional integration and social corporate investment (shared value).

Industry and Professional Experience:
Previous experience includes Chief Executive Officer of the Southern Africa Trust from 2014 to 2018; Deputy Executive Director of the Southern Africa Trust; Director of Programmes at Trust Africa; Research Fellow at Trust Africa; Senior Researcher, Centre for Governance, IDASA; Research Specialist at the Africa Institute of South Africa, and Research Manager at Tshwaranang Legal Advocacy Centre, Johannesburg.

Board memberships include International Advisory Council Member of Afrobarometer; SIVIO Institute-Board Chair; Association for Research on Civil Society in Africa-Board Chair; International Society for Third Sector Research (Secretary of the Board - 2014, board member to date); Accountability Lab-Zimbabwe (Founding Board member 2020); Alliance Magazine Editorial Board (2014 to date), and Nonprofit and Voluntary Sector Quarterly (NVSQ) Editorial Board member (2019 to date).

Professional memberships include International Society for Third Sector Research; Association for Research on Nonprofit Organisations and Voluntary Action; Association for Research on Civil Society in Africa, and Council for the Development of Social Sciences Research in Africa (CODESRIA).

Recent consultancies:
Barriers to civil society’s efforts to build capacity and scale up (Vodafone Report); COVID 19 and its effects on civil society advocacy in Africa (Advocacy Accelerator Report); Governing the shrinking civic space in Africa Governance Institute-CODESRIA (Director); The civic shrinking space for women and girls, CODESRIA (main report); Policy brief on the civic space for women and girls; Associations and associational life in Zimbabwe, UNDP Human Development Report (Chapter contribution); CSOs’ readiness to adapt and adopt 4th Industrial Revolution strategies - A study of 50 CSOs in Zimbabwe (Zimbabwe Institute Report); Development of a resource mobilisation strategy for SARW (Southern Africa Resource Watch); Development of the Mandela Institute for Development Studies organisational strategy.
